Abstract
Ultrasonic detection method is used in this system, a solutions based on the uClinux embedded operating system and Samsung S3C2410 processor is proposed. The hardware design and software design for system are discussed in detail. The paper studies the application technology of Neural networks and wavelet transform in PD online monitoring system in power transformer. This system has the characteristic of small volume, low cost, high accuracy, high reliability and etc. It can be used widely in future.
